HATCHERY HARDWARE SUPERVISOR (MACHINERY AND STORAGE)
Reports to: Hatchery Hardware Team Lead
Division: Production
Department: Hardware and Expansion
Grade: M1
Direct Reports: Aeration Team, Water Supply & Control Team, Storage & Inventory Team
JOB OVERVIEW:
The Hatchery Hardware Supervisor (Machinery & Storage) supervises hatchery machinery operations, aeration systems, water distribution, and storage facilities. The role ensures continuous equipment availability, safe storage of materials, and strict adherence to health, safety, and biosecurity requirements.
KEY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Machinery and Operations Oversight
- Supervise aeration and water supply teams to ensure reliable functionality.
- Oversee preventive maintenance of pumps, blowers, and motors.
- Plan resource allocation for equipment servicing and repairs.
- Storage and Inventory Management
- Supervise inventory handling of tools, chemicals, and spare parts.
- Monitor stock levels and initiate reorders in advance.
- Ensure safe storage, handling, and labelling of chemicals.
- Health, Safety, and Biosecurity
- Enforce safety standards for machinery operators.
- Conduct regular risk assessments of equipment and storage facilities.
- Ensure compliance with environmental and biosecurity policies.
- Reporting and Communication
- Maintain records of maintenance schedules, equipment logs, and stock.
- Submit weekly reports to the Team Lead on equipment status and inventory.
- Coordinate with procurement and engineering teams.
- Perform any other duties as assigned by the line manager
Q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S REQUIRED:
- Bachelor’s degree in engineering, Aquaculture, or related technical field.
- 2+ years’ experience in machinery handling or aquaculture equipment management.
- Strong knowledge of maintenance procedures and inventory systems.
- Proven ability to supervise and coordinate teams.
- High regard for health, safety, and biosecurity standards.
